Review Sonny Erricson C905




The Sony Ericsson C905 Cyber-shot is a revolutionary mobile that comes with 8 mega pixels worth of camera. It supports face detection, smart contrast, both a xenon flash and a photo flash. The 2.4-inch QVGA TFT that supports it well to display high resolution images. The Sony Ericsson C905 is a high-end camera phone with a 8 megapixel Canon EOS-1D.



The Sony Ericsson C905 Cyber-shot comes with a built-in accelerometer for screen auto rotation, TV-out port, GPS and Wi-Fi support.



The Sony Ericsson C905 Cyber-shot comes with a thickness of 18mm.



Specification:



General

2G Network: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G Network: HSDPA 2100 - C905
Size Dimensions: 104 x 49 x 18-19.5 mmWeight: 136 g
Weight: 136 g

Display

Type: TFT, 256K colors
Size: 240 x 320 pixels, 2.4 inches
Accelerometer sensor for auto-rotate
Ringtones Type: Polyphonic, MP3
Memory Phonebook 1000 x 20 fields, Photo callCall records 30 received, dialed and missed calls
Card slot Memory Stick Micro (M2), 2 GB card included- 160 MB internal memory

Data


GPRS Class 10 (4+1/3+2 slots), 32 - 48 kbps
HSCSD No
EDGE Class 10, 236.8 kbps
3G HSDPA
WLAN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g
Bluetooth Yes, v2.0 with A2DP
Infrared port No
USB Yes

Features


Messaging SMS, MMS, Email, Instant Messaging
Browser WAP 2.0/HTML (NetFront), RSS reader
Games Yes + downloadable
Colors Night Black, Ice Silver, Copper Gold
Camera 8 MP, 3264×2448 pixels, autofocus, image stabiliser, video(QVGA 30fps), xenon flash; secondary videocall camera

- Built-in GPS receiver
- A-GPS function
- Camera images geo-tagging
- Java MIDP 2.0
- FM radio with RDS
- MP3/AAC/MPEG4 player
- TrackID music recognition
- Picture editor/blogging
- TV out
- Organiser
- Built-in handsfree
- Voice memo/dial

Battery

Standard battery, Li-Po 930 mAh (BST-38)
Stand-by Up to 380 h
Talk time Up to 9 h
